Notes
Only one Web server (Interstage HTTP Server) can be used as the business server for Single
Sign-on in one system.
If Microsoft(R) Internet Explorer is used as a Web browser, a business system setup file with an
absolute path name that exceeds 200 bytes in length, may not be able to be specified by using
the Browse button. In this case, allocate the business system setup file so that the absolute
path is sufficiently short.
If Interstage HTTP Server is to be used, operation using the virtual host function of Interstage
HTTP Server is not supported.
If a business server is set up for the port number to be used by the virtual host function, it is not
access controlled.
When a business server is started, the configurations of all business servers on the same
system are checked for errors. If one of the configurations is invalid, information is output to the
system log. In this case the Web server starts, but returns the message “500 Internal Server
Error” for all accesses from the user.
The business system setup file is important for security. After the business server has been set
up, ensure that the business system setup file is deleted.
Setting up the Second and Subsequent Business Servers for
Load Balancing
This section explains how to add business servers for load balancing.
If a load balancer (such as Interstage Traffic Director) is used to distribute business server load, the
second and subsequent servers must be configured with the same environment as the first server.
Interstage Single Sign-on provides the ssocloneaz command to set up business servers with the same
environment.
The ssocloneaz command also replicates messages to be displayed in a Web browser. Before making
a replicate of business server, customize messages. For details about how to customize messages to
be displayed in a Web browser, refer to “Customizing Messages Displayed on a Web Browser”.
